EVADA COUNTY IS A DESTINATION throughout the year. Each season has its attractions, however fall is
notable for its colorful foliage. Early settlers are credited with planting trees, especially maples, th at reminded
them of their homes back east. Today, Grass Valley and Nevada City can claim some of the best color in the
west which begins to intensify in October and is often at its peak from mid-month into early November. But weather is
always a factor, so a call to the chambers of Commerce can give up-to-date information.
Although spectacular foliage is scattered throughout both towns, there are some popular areas. For example, check
out the streets adjacent to downtown Nevada City. Then visit Nevada Street on the other side of the freeway. In Grass
Valley, explore the streets uphill from downtown. Walk up Neal Street to Pleasant Street, then back on Neal to High
Street, turn left and right on West Main Street. Also, take a drive to Empire Mine State Park off Hwy. 174.
